Brief Summary

Dysregulation of the Angiopoietin-2 (Ang-2)/Tyrosine kinase with Immunoglobulin-like and EGF-like domains 2 (Tie-2) signaling pathway has been implicated in choroidal vascular instability and RPE dysfunction in Central serous chorioretinopathy (CSCR) and pachychoroid-associated neovascularization. This study prospectively evaluates the efficacy and safety of faricimab compared to sham in CSCR with and without secondary neovascularization, using standardized anatomical and functional endpoints. The results of this trial may help define the role of dual pathway inhibition in CSCR and inform future treatment strategies for this challenging and vision threatening condition.

Outcome Measures

Primary Outcomes (1)

  • The efficacy of 3 loading doses of IVT faricimab compared with sham treatment in achieving anatomical improvement in eyes with chronic CSCR with presence of foveal sub-retinal fluid (SRF), with or without secondary macular neoascularization (MNV).

    Assessed by the proportion of eyes achieving achieving complete resolution of SRF on optical coherence tomography (OCT) at Month 3.

    3 months.

Secondary Outcomes (13)

  • The proportion of eyes achieving a ≥20% reduction in central retinal thickness (CRT) from baseline at month 3 and month 6.

    6 months.

  • The proportion of eyes achieving complete resolution of intraretinal and/or SRF from month 1 through month 6.

    6 months.

  • The time to first resolution of intraretinal and/or SRF.

    6 months.

  • The mean change in best corrected visual acuity (BCVA) from baseline to months 3 and 6.

    6 months.

  • The mean change in CRT from baseline to months 3 and 6.

    6 months.

Interventions

Intravitreal faricimab 6 mg at baseline, month 1, and month 2, followed by protocol-defined Pro Re Nata (PRN) dosing at monthly visits through Month 6.

Intravitreal injection (IVT) arm
ShamDRUG

Sham injections at baseline, month 1, and month 2. After assessment of the primary endpoint at Month 3, participants randomized to the sham arm who demonstrate persistent intraretinal and/or subretinal fluid will switch to intravitreal faricimab treatment by protocol-defined PRN dosing at monthly visits through Month 6.

Eligibility Criteria

Age21 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Age ≥21 years at the time of consent.
  • Best corrected visual acuity between 24 and 73 ETDRS letters (approximately Snellen equivalent 20/32 to 20/300) in the study eye.
  • Diagnosis of chronic CSCR, defined as the presence of persistent SRF for ≥3 months, with or without secondary MNV.
  • Presence of pachychoroid features, including pachyvessels on ultra-widefield imaging in at least one quadrant and SFCT ≥300 µm.
  • Presence of intraretinal fluid and/or subretinal fluid involving the fovea, as confirmed by OCT.
  • Disease duration criteria:
  • CSCR without secondary MNV: persistent subretinal fluid for ≥3 months despite observation, or
  • CSCR with secondary MNV: presence of exudative fluid of any duration, with neovascularization confirmed on OCTA.
  • Ability and willingness to provide written informed consent.
  • Women of childbearing potential must have a negative pregnancy test prior to enrollment and agree to use a reliable form of contraception for the duration of the study.

You may not qualify if:

  • Presence of ocular inflammation or primary choroidal disorders.
  • Presence of polypoidal choroidal vasculopathy (PCV).
  • Any ocular condition that, in the opinion of the investigator, could affect intra- or subretinal fluid or significantly alter visual acuity during the study (e.g., diabetic macular edema, retinal vein occlusion, uveitis, neovascular glaucoma).
  • Clinically significant cataract likely to reduce visual acuity by more than three ETDRS lines (i.e., worse than approximately 20/40 if the eye were otherwise normal).
  • Any intraocular surgery within 3 months prior to enrollment.
  • Prior treatment in the study eye with:
  • Intravitreal corticosteroids (any time),
  • Anti-VEGF therapy within 6 months, or
  • Photodynamic therapy (any time).
  • History of retinal detachment or surgery for retinal detachment, prior vitrectomy, or presence of a full-thickness macular hole.
  • Evidence of vitreomacular traction that may preclude resolution of macular edema.
  • Extensive intra- or subretinal hemorrhage exceeding 4 disc areas.
  • Aphakia in the study eye.
  • Pregnancy or breastfeeding.
  • Any medical, psychiatric, or systemic condition that, in the opinion of the investigator, would make study participation unsafe or interfere with study assessments.
